CZECH COULDN'T BELIEVE THIS PLACE EXISTS IN NAIROBI,KENYA
30:32
CITY OF (CHAOS) | Nairobi, the capital city of Kenya
13:24
Jamhuri Day 2024 | What Really Happens Behind the Scenes!
18:51
The Worst Place To Live In Nairobi! What a shame! 🇰🇪
10:23
Breaking! RUTI Mocked By Citizen TV After Kenyans Boycott Uhuru Gardens Jamuhuri Day Celebration
9:31
Driving in Nairobi CBD from UoN to OTC, Kenya
9:18
Top Ten Tallest Skyscrapers in Kenya 2023
11:25
Nairobi is not what you THINK it is!!! This is the Africa they don't show you!
4:05